Levington ward are recruiting for a new ward clerk who will be able to work autonomously, be able to prioritise their workload, and work well within our team.
You will have the ability to communicate effectively with members of the public, both face-to-face and over the phone. You will be working across Levington ward and MSKAU over 5 days Monday-Friday.
Ward clerks are the first point of contact for visitors and patients to the ward, so we need someone who will ensure that the Trust's 'OAK' Values are used at all times to ensure the best patient experience.
We are an extremely motivated and passionate team determined to deliver excellent and high standards of holistic nursing care in a pleasant environment with friendly and supportive staff.
Your duties will include admission and discharge of patients on Lorenzo and Evolve computer systems, booking of appointments and filing of notes, answering phones and liaising with multidisciplinary teams/departments across the trust.
You should be able to work autonomously, be able to prioritise your workload and to work well within a team.
It would be beneficial to have NHS experience and possess excellent IT and clerical skills.
You will be dealing with the staff and general public so it is paramount that you have good people skills.
Working hours will be varied, so you must be flexible.

Arrange patient appointments.
Check computer details each morning and expected dates of discharge, updating as required.
Maintain safe and tidy working environment, update ward notice boards and report maintenance problems to estates.
Maintain confidentiality at all times relating to patient care within the ward area.
Assist the Ward Sister in undertaking clerical duties/administration duties.
To welcome patients and visitors to the ward in an appropriate manner, showing them to the bed on request.
